2. Local SEO: Dominating Your Area
As a psychiatrist, your goal is to attract local patients. That’s where Local SEO comes in.
What is Local SEO?
Local SEO focuses on optimizing your online presence to appear in location-based searches, such as:
- “Psychiatrist in [City]”
- “Child psychiatrist near me”
- “Mental health clinic open now”
How to Improve Local SEO
- Claim and optimize your Google Business Profile (GBP)
- Include NAP (Name, Address, Phone) consistently across all platforms
- Get listed in local directories
- Encourage and respond to Google reviews
- Add location-based keywords to your website
Ranking well locally means more patients in your city or neighborhood will find and contact you directly.
3. Building Trust with On-Page SEO
When someone lands on your website, they’re looking for information, credibility, and reassurance. On-page SEO ensures your site provides a great user experience while being optimized for search engines.
Key On-Page SEO Elements
- Title Tags and Meta Descriptions with keywords like “psychiatrist in [City]” or “therapy for anxiety”
- H1, H2, and H3 Headings that clearly organize your content
- Keyword-rich content that answers patient questions
- Image alt texts for accessibility and SEO
- Internal linking to blog posts, service pages, and FAQs
Your goal is to create content that answers patients’ questions and helps them feel confident in reaching out to your practice.

6. Mobile Optimization is Non-Negotiable
In 2025, mobile devices dominate internet use. Google uses mobile-first indexing, meaning your site’s mobile version is what determines your rankings.
Mobile Optimization Checklist
- Use responsive design for all screen sizes
- Compress images for faster loading
- Ensure text is legible without zooming
- Make buttons and links easily clickable
- Simplify navigation and forms
If your website isn’t mobile-friendly, you could lose both rankings and potential patients.
7. Technical SEO: The Foundation of a Strong Website
Behind the scenes, technical SEO ensures that your site is crawlable, fast, and secure. Even the best content won’t rank if search engines can’t access it properly.
Essential Technical SEO Tasks
- Use HTTPS (SSL certificate)
- Improve page speed
- Fix broken links and 404 errors
- Submit an XML sitemap to Google
- Use structured data (schema markup) for medical professionals
Hiring a web developer or SEO expert can help ensure your website meets all the necessary technical standards in 2025.

10. Tracking and Measuring SEO Success
To know whether your SEO strategy is working, you need to measure your progress.
Key Metrics to Track
- Organic traffic (Google Analytics)
- Keyword rankings (SEMrush or Ahrefs)
- Bounce rate and time on site
- Conversion rate (form submissions or calls)
- Google Business Profile engagement
Regularly review your analytics to adjust your content and SEO tactics based on real data.
11. SEO vs. Paid Ads: What Should Psychiatrists Choose?
Aspect | SEO | Paid Ads (PPC) |
---|---|---|
Cost | Long-term investment | Ongoing budget required |
Speed | Takes time to build | Instant visibility |
Sustainability | Long-lasting results | Stops when budget stops |
Trust Factor | Higher credibility | Seen as promotional |
For most psychiatrists, a mix of SEO and paid ads provides the best results. Start with SEO for a strong foundation and use paid ads for targeted campaigns or fast patient acquisition.
